🛠️ Repair Help sealant for stone

I've reattached some stackstone facing that fell off an exterior wall - now I want to seal small gaps where things didn't quite fit.

Can anyone recommend a CLEAR sealant that bonds to stone and mortar?

Sanded grout in a caulk tube would work better than most clear sealants for stone gaps, but if you want clear specifically, polyurethane construction adhesive stays flexible and bonds well to masonry. Just mask the edges first because it gets messy fast.
